    You're just playing a demo, reviewers have had the full game. Definitely play it a little more, though. The gameplay hook for Bioshock is the Plasmids. It gives you toys to play with in the environment. You only get 2 Plasmids in the demo (Lightning and Fire), and there are quite a few things you can do with just those.

    For one thing, if you set someone on fire and there's water nearby, they'll dive into the water to douse themselves. Then you can use the lightning to shock them (and anything else nearby) while they're in the water. That's probably one of the most basic things you can do.

    In the demo, I've heard you can hack the security bots and even make a molotov cocktail (bottle of alcohol+fire=boombottle).


    It's about creativity. If you don't play the game creatively, you'll probably think it's a decent shooter but not see what the hype is about. The game encourages you to try different things in the game. If you ever had a "I wonder if I can do this..." thought, try it. It might work.

    When you finish the demo, watch the video that plays. It shows you a couple of the other creative combinations you can use.
